Abstract

The invention relates to a novel LED billboard. The novel LED billboard comprises a transparent casing, wherein bottom telescopic rods are connected to four bottom corners of the transparent casing, universal balls are arranged at the bottom ends of the bottom telescopic rods, and external threads are arranged at the lower parts of the bottom telescopic rods and are in threaded connection with outer casing pipes; a mounting board is arranged in the transparent casing, and the bottom end of the mounting board is connected with the bottom wall of the transparent casing through top telescopic rods and spiral damping springs; a vibration sensor, a microcontroller, an LED display, an alarm and a storage battery for supplying power are arranged on the mounting board, a motor is arranged at the top end in the transparent casing, an output shaft end of the motor is connected with a screw, the bottom end of the screw is rotationally connected with the bottom wall of the transparent casing through a bearing, a brush rod is in thread fit on the screw, and bristles are uniformly distributed on the brush rod. With adoption of the structure, the novel LED billboard can be moved and fixed conveniently and has a good damping function, and the inside of the LED billboard can be cleaned conveniently.

technical field [0001] The invention relates to a novel LED billboard. Background technique [0002] In various commercial and living places, various billboards are often used for better advertising. However, for the existing billboards, due to structural and design constraints, they cannot be flexibly moved and fixed in position. Avoid being subjected to external shocks, which can easily cause damage to its internal circuit components; in addition, it is often difficult to clean the fog or dust generated inside the billboard, which greatly affects the performance and scope of application of the billboard. Contents of the invention [0003] In order to overcome the above deficiencies in the prior art, the technical problem to be solved by the present invention is to provide a device that can move and fix the position conveniently and flexibly, and also has good shock-absorbing and buffering performance.
